About Hahap Village

Hahap is a large village in Namkum tehsil, in the district of Ranchi, Jharkhand.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 2,092, made up of 1,042 males and 1,050 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,008 females per 1000 males. The village covers 1338 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 834010,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Hahap

The census records public bus service for Hahap as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 10+ km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
